The Date: A Strategic Masterstroke? 🗓️
While the delay is painful, trade experts are calling the new date a "Goldmine."
The Date: March 5, 2027.
The Festival: The release coincides with Maha Shivratri (March 6) and leads into the Eid window later in the month.
The Logic: By skipping the overcrowded December 2026 slot (which already has potential Hollywood biggies and other pan-India clashes), Spirit gets a solo, open run in the lucrative pre-summer period.
The "Pan-World" Vision 🌍
The makers have reiterated that Spirit isn't just a Pan-India film; it's a "Pan-World" release.
Languages: It will release in Hindi, Telugu, Tamil, Malayalam, Kannada, Japanese, Chinese, and Korean.
The Cast: Alongside Prabhas (who plays a ruthless, honest cop), the film stars Triptii Dimri as the female lead and Vivek Oberoi in a pivotal negative role.
